Recipe preparation for Shrimp and Crab Au Gratin – Seafood Main Dish

How to Make Shrimp and Crab Au Gratin – Seafood Main Dish

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ious dish:

Step 1: Preheat Your Oven

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Grease a baking dish with nonstick cooking spray or butter to ensure nothing sticks.

Step 2: Sauté the Seafood

In a large skillet over medium heat, melt two tablespoons of butter. Add the fresh shrimp and crab meat, sautéing until they turn pink and opaque—about three minutes should do it. Remove from heat and set aside.

Step 3: Create the Roux

In the same skillet, melt another two tablespoons of butter over medium-low heat. Stir in the flour and cook for about one minute until golden brown. Slowly whisk in the heavy cream until smooth.

Step 4: Season It Up

Add minced garlic, salt, pepper, and half of your shredded cheese blend to the roux. Stir until fully melted and combined—this will be your creamy base packed with flavor!

Step 5: Combine Everything

Gently fold in the sautéed shrimp and crab mixture into your creamy sauce until well coated. Pour everything into your greased baking dish.

Step 6: Top It Off

Sprinkle remaining cheese on top along with breadcrumbs for that crispy finish. Bake uncovered in your preheated oven for about 20-25 minutes or until bubbly and golden brown.

Perfecting the Cooking Process

Start by sautéing the shrimp and crab in butter until they are just cooked through. While that’s happening, prepare your cheese sauce on the side. Combine everything in a baking dish, top with breadcrumbs, and pop it into the oven until golden brown.

Add Your Touch

Feel free to swap out shrimp for lobster or even add some veggies like spinach or bell peppers. Experiment with different cheeses; Gruyère or cheddar can give your dish a unique twist. You can also sprinkle in some herbs for an extra flavor boost.

Storing & Reheating

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. To reheat, simply cover with foil and warm in the oven at 350°F until heated through to preserve that creamy goodness.

Chef's Helpful Tips

  • For perfectly melted cheese, mix different types like mozzarella and cheddar.
  • Avoid overcooking seafood by removing it when it’s slightly underdone; it will continue cooking in the oven.
  • Don’t skip the breadcrumbs—they add a delightful crunch!

Shrimp and Crab Au Gratin

  • Author: Camiliya
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 25 minutes
  • Total Time: 40 minutes
  • Yield: Approximately 4 servings 1x
  • Category: Main Dish
  • Method: Baking
  • Cuisine: Seafood
Print Recipe
Pin Recipe

Description

Indulge in this creamy Shrimp and Crab Au Gratin, featuring succulent seafood enveloped in rich flavors and a crispy topping—perfect for any gathering or cozy dinner!


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ound fresh shrimp (peeled and deveined)
  • 8 ounces fresh lump crab meat
  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 2 cloves garlic (minced)
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 cup shredded cheese (Gruyère and Parmesan blend)
  • 1/2 cup breadcrumbs (preferably panko)
  • Additional shredded cheese for topping

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Grease a baking dish with nonstick cooking spray.
  2. In a skillet over medium heat, melt 2 tablespoons of butter. Add shrimp and crab meat, sautéing until pink and opaque (about 3 minutes). Remove from heat.
  3. In the same skillet, melt remaining butter over medium-low heat. Stir in flour, cooking for about 1 minute until golden brown.
  4. Gradually whisk in heavy cream until smooth. Add minced garlic, salt, pepper, and half of the shredded cheese; stir until melted.
  5. Fold sautéed shrimp and crab into the creamy sauce until well-coated. Pour mixture into the greased baking dish.
  6. Top with remaining cheese and breadcrumbs. Bake uncovered for about 20-25 minutes or until bubbly and golden brown.
